On this episode, the brothers Weinbrecht get a special phone call from the "Michael Jordan of Wrestling Figure Collecting" himself, pro wrestler Matt Cardona! Hear about his collection, what he's buying, what he's excited about, and his new spin-off podcast on this very special edition of Adventures in Collecting.

Fine. So now going back into like, you know, even like the flea market days are going to like, you know, so many different stores. What has changed for you as far as how you find stuff?
00:29:28
Speaker
Um, like, cause now I will use the internet and then use these Facebook groups. So like, uh, like a Facebook group is where you'll find the rare stuff for me. Like eBay, you don't, I don't find, I haven't found any like prototype except for the joint, the clown orange card on eBay. They were all found through private sellers on Facebook groups.
00:29:52
Speaker
We've we've heard time and time again now that it once you get into the prototype market It's it's private faith private invite only Facebook groups and like once you get into one Then you can get into two and three and that's where you start finding. You know this crazy shit
00:30:07
Speaker
Well, I mean, and that's where it is. And because like people don't want to deal with the eBay fees, the PayPal fees has gotten ridiculous. And plus the tax, you got to pay the IRS, you got to pay micro time debt at the end of the year. You know what I'm saying? So if you can just do a private deal, you'll save money because you won't have the eBay fees, you won't have the PayPal fees. Everybody wins. Everybody wins.
